17, The Willows, Bolton is described in the public record as a modern house with 785 ft2 of internal area.
Locally, houses of this size norm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Our estimate of the sale value of 17, The Willows, Bolton is £196,388 and its rental estimate is £1,282 per month, given the available information and assuming reasonable condition.

The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 17, The Willows, Bolton, we estimate a market value of £206,208 and a rental value of £1,346 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£182,641 and £1,192 per month respectively.
Over the last year, 17, The Willows, Bolton has seen its estimated sale value climb by £9,178 (4.7%) and its estimated rental value rise by £43 per month (3.3%). This results in an estimated gross rental yield of 7.8%.
17, The Willows, Bolton has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 29 Nov 2021.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
